SkyDrive和Dropbox的api具有管理用戶整個驅動器的選項。對於Google Drive,drive.file範圍似乎只允許訪問由應用程序創建的文件。 是否有Google Drive的範圍可以訪問整個驅動器?訪問用戶的Google Drive上的所有文件
8
A
回答
3
編輯:下面的回答是是正確的,但最新版本的Drive API允許使用https://www.googleapis.com/auth/drive
請求整個範圍。文檔列表API不再需要用於此用例。請參閱https://developers.google.com/drive/scopes#requesting_full_drive_scope_for_an_app
確切地說,Drive API允許訪問由應用程序創建的文件以及用戶使用應用程序從Drive UI(通過打開)打開的文件。
要操縱用戶的所有Drive文件,您可以使用Google Document List API。儘管我們目前禁止使用Drive應用程序(通過Open-with和Create對話框集成到Drive UI中的應用程序)請求訪問文檔列表API,因爲我們希望將Drive應用程序保留在每個文件的安全模型中。 (基本上在Drive SDK設置中添加文檔列表範圍會引發錯誤)。
相關問題
- 1. 訪問Google Drive
- 2. 列出Google Drive中的所有文件
- 3. 使用AuthSubUtil.exchangeForSessionToken的Google Drive訪問
- 4. 上傳文件到Google Drive
- 5. 列出Google Drive SDK中的所有文件夾及其文件
- 6. 從Perl訪問Google Drive SDK
- 7. Google Drive訪問經過身份驗證的用戶數據
- 8. node.js/google drive sdk v3:訪問webContentLink(和所有圖像元數據)
- 9. 來自服務器的Google Drive API訪問文件
- 10. 使用Google Drive API上傳文件
- 11. 使用GoogleAuthUtil令牌訪問Google Drive API
- 12. Google Drive API v2 - 列出所有標籤/限制= false的文件
- 13. 列出Google Drive API中的所有頂級文件夾
- 14. 使用.Net列出Google Drive V2中的所有文件和文件夾
- 15. OAuth訪問Google Drive授權問題
- 16. Google Drive API v2:將文件所有權轉讓給管理員用戶
- 17. Google Drive API:複製帶有服務帳戶的文件
- 18. Google Drive SDK - 如何獲取文件所在的文件夾?
- 19. 將文件上傳到Google Drive與iOS的問題
- 20. 如何使用Drive SDK列出域中的所有Google文檔?
- 21. Google Drive - 訪問文件樹條目及其類型
- 22. 如何訪問Google Apps for Business網域中的所有用戶?
- 23. Google Drive問題
- 24. Google Drive API上傳/創建文件(.NET)
- 25. 將大文件上傳到Google Drive
- 26. 將文件上傳到Google Drive
- 27. Google Drive API上傳到父文件夾
- 28. 如何將文件上傳到Google Drive
- 29. 授予Google服務帳戶訪問我所有的Google Analytics帳戶的權限
- 30. 從Google Drive獲取所有文件(和父文件夾)的列表
其中是讓客戶端知道該應用程序創建的文件列表的API函數? – FxIII 2012-05-20 12:31:57
試圖在Drive API上使用範圍https://www.googleapis.com/auth/drive,不起作用:http://stackoverflow.com/a/31138102/377320 – 2015-06-30 12:21:50